From a practical standpoint, the accessibility of these pages is a primary driver of their success. A simple Google search for "gacha coloring pages printable" yields thousands of results, offering a near-infinite variety of subjects. This contrasts sharply with the physical world, where finding a specific licensed character coloring page might require purchasing a specific book or magazine. The digital format allows for a democratization of creativity; independent artists can upload their own designs, offering characters that are not tied to major franchises. This has fostered a vibrant community of creators and sharers. Parents appreciate the low cost and high entertainment value, needing only a printer and some crayons. Teachers use them as rewards or quiet-time activities, while adults find them a readily available source of stress relief. The environmental impact is also a positive factor; one can print a single page as needed, avoiding the waste of an entire coloring book, and the digital files can be stored indefinitely, ensuring the art is preserved for future enjoyment. Ultimately, gacha coloring pages are more than just a pastime. They are a testament to how digital trends can be translated into tangible, creative experiences, satisfying our deepest urges to collect, create, and remember, all within the simple, satisfying act of filling a line with color.

Financially, 2017 was a significant year for Whitaker. That year, he starred in two major cinematic events that broadened his audience and undoubtedly impacted his bank account. The first was his role as Saw Gerrera in the *Star Wars* franchise, appearing in the critically divisive but commercially massive *Rogue One: A Star Wars Story*. While some fans were divided on his character, being part of the billion-dollar *Star Wars* universe is a guaranteed financial windfall. He commanded a substantial fee for his appearance in the film, contributing significantly to his earnings for the year. The second was the historical drama *Marshall*, where he played the legendary lawyer Thurgood Marshall. Though the film had a modest box office reception, it positioned Whitaker as a serious dramatic lead in a major studio release, further proving his bankability outside of the sci-fi franchise.

However, no discussion of Tonya Hardings net worth is complete without addressing the elephant in the room: the 1994 attack on her rival, Nancy Kerrigan. The scandal that followed shattered her career, her reputation, and her financial stability. While Harding denied direct involvement for years, she eventually pleaded guilty to hindering the prosecution after it was revealed her ex-husband, Jeff Gillooly, and his co-conspirator, Shawn Eckardt, had orchestrated the attack. The fallout was immediate and catastrophic. She was banned from amateur competition by the United States Figure Skating Association, a move that stripped her of her livelihood. Her sponsors, including the lucrative deal with Mattel for a Barbie doll in her likeness, were dropped without hesitation. The media circus that followed turned her into a global pariah, and any potential for future earnings evaporated. Legal fees began to pile up, and the financial security she had built was crumbling before her eyes. During this period, her net worth likely plummeted, potentially into negative territory as she faced substantial legal debts.
